Testing Droitwich's new duck vending machine

Feeding the ducks has been elevated to the 21st century at Vines Park, with a solar-powered vending machine made from 20,000 recycled plastic bottles.

Officials say the sustainable machine helps visitors and families feed the wild birds the 'right' way, with a nutritious alternative to bread. Each lot of pellets cost £1 via contactless payments.
